This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] MSP432E401Y:参考手册中有关USBRXDPKTBUFDIS的信息相互矛盾

Guru**** 2539500 points
Other Parts Discussed in Thread: TM4C123GH6PM

请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/microcontrollers/arm-based-microcontrollers-group/arm-based-microcontrollers/f/arm-based-microcontrollers-forum/1103079/msp432e401y-contradictory-information-in-reference-manual-regarding-usbrxdpktbufdis

部件号:MSP432E401Y
主题中讨论的其他部件:TM4C123GH6PM

MSP432E4技术参考手册(文献编号:SLAU723A) 提供了有关 USBRXDPKTBUFDIS位值的自相矛盾的信息

表27-73. USBRXDPKTBUFDIS寄存器字段描述为"0x1 =启用双数据包缓冲"

但“ 双数据包缓冲”(Not in Paragraph 27.3 .1.3 2 Double-Packet Buffering)中说:

如果在中设置了端点的对应EPN位,则禁用双数据包缓冲
USB Receive Double Packet Buffer Disable (USBRXDPKTBUFDIS)寄存器。 此位已设置
默认情况下,因此必须清除它才能启用双数据包缓冲。"

那么,哪一个是正确的? 是否应设置或清除该位以启用双数据包缓冲?

我试图通过类比查看另一台设备来找到答案,但它看起来与TM4C123GH6PM在技术Manuel中存在完全相同的矛盾...